Output 39c3143315817b876e488b02943429c605cc7b845c2ff3148a9b4d80eca22734:1

value
73308653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38c61f7d97d394fc80fdf59118651e52f6a943c5 OP_EQUALVERIFY OP_CHECKSIG
address
16BCBa6Rxj7gjgzBhTbrfN3thR8ng9eEum
transaction
39c3143315817b876e488b02943429c605cc7b845c2ff3148a9b4d80eca22734
spent
true